d.
Remove flywheel tightening handle.
NOTE
Make sure bolts holding flywheel extractor are screwed in
deep enough to prevent stripping of the tapped holes
e.
Remove flywheel (5) by using the special flywheel extractor (refer to Figure 5-42). Be sure to tighten
nuts on flywheel extractor evenly.
f.
When flywheel (5) loosens on tapered crankshaft (6), remove the tool.
g.
Remove flywheel (5).
Be careful not to damage the taper part of the crankshaft
h.
Remove flywheel key (7) from crankshaft (6).
INSTALLATION:
a.
Install flywheel key (7) onto crankshaft (6).
